About the Allied Health Assistant - Dietetics, DE, CN role
Join our Dietetics, Diabetes Education and Community Nursing team and work with diverse clients and groups, delivering hands-on care, assisting with programs and helping drive inclusive, person-centred health outcomes. Reporting to the Dietetics, Diabetes Education & Community Nursing Coordinator, this is a ongoing part-time role (0.5 FTE). Offices located in the Northern Suburbs.
Your Passion and Commitment will see you:
- Perform all duties of Grade 1 and 2 AHAs
- Build strong, person-centred relationships across teams and services
- Assist with planning, student placements, stock and clinical audits
- Deliver safe, high-quality care with minimal supervision
- Support client progress with nutrition risk checks and group sessions
To succeed in this role you will have:
- Certificate III or IV in Allied Health Assistance or equivalent and / or relevant work experience.
- Minimum three years full-time equivalent experience as a Grade 2 Allied Health Assistant.
- Current Victorian Driver’s Licence
- Current First Aid Certificate or willingness to obtain.
